Step 2a: Optimized mode - Automatic scanning of remote shared disks
Available from 9.2.12.
To discover software that is installed on shared disks in your
infrastructure, enable automatic scanning of shared disks. As a result, a single computer is
designated to scan a specific shared disk and discover the installed software. The data is
then automatically populated to all computers on which the same shared disk is mounted. Use
this mode when a single shared disk is mounted on many computers.
Before you begin
- This method of scanning is advised for environments with a heavy use of shared disks in which a single shared disk is mounted on many computers. For information, see: Discovering software on shared disks.
- This method is not supported in environments in which multiple instances of BigFix Inventory use a single BigFix server as the data source.
You must be an Administrator to perform this task.- Ensure that the parameter enable_automatic_task_deployment is set to true on the Advanced Server Settings panel. It is the default setting.
Procedure
- Discover shared disks that exist in your infrastructure.
-
Enable optimized scan of shared disks.
-
Wait for the scheduled import or run it manually.
During the import, a single computer is designated to scan a specific shared disk. An action that is called Optimized Shared Disks Scan Update Resources List is created on the BigFix server. Each action represents designation of a single computer. Additionally, the software scan is triggered on every designated computer.Important: Because these actions are triggered during the first import after you enable the scanning, it might take a couple of consecutive imports to discover software that is installed on shared disks.
